2. Master the Art of Layering

The secret to winter comfort lies in layering. Begin with a moisture-wicking base layer that keeps sweat away from your skin. Add a fleece or insulated mid-layer to trap body heat, and finish with a windproof, waterproof shell to seal it all in. This system lets you adapt to changing conditions without overheating.

3. Protect Your Extremities

Cold hands and feet can ruin any outdoor plan. Opt for thermal gloves that let you use your phone, merino wool socks for moisture control, and insulated boots with reliable traction. Don’t forget a warm hat or beanie : up to 10% of body heat escapes from your head.

4. Add the Essential Accessories

Small things make a big difference. A neck gaiter, balaclava, or thermal face mask helps block icy winds. Pair these with polarized sunglasses or ski goggles if you’ll be outdoors for long hours — glare from snow can be surprisingly harsh.

5. Stay Dry, Stay Hydrated

Moisture is your enemy in winter. Choose breathable, waterproof materials to prevent internal condensation while keeping snow and rain out. And remember- dehydration happens even in cold weather, so carry a thermal water bottle to keep drinks warm and accessible.
